    Why I did not panic during chaotic stage collapse a Lagos show – Odumodublvck opens up

    Nigerian rapper, Odumodublvck has broken his silence following the stage collapsed incident which occurred during his performance at SoL Beach, Elegushi area of Lagos State on December 21, 2024.

    TheNewsGuru.com learnt that the event, powered by Nativeland, turned chaotic after the structure collapsed while the rapper was entertaining fans, causing panic among attendees.

    Following the stage collapse, concerned netizens flooded social media, praying for the safety of the performers and team members.

    In an interview with HIPTV, Odumodublvck reflected on the chaotic event, emphasising his unshaken faith.

    “For some reason, I wasn’t scared and I didn’t panic because God is always in me and for some reason, I didn’t panic at all,” he said.

    The 31-year-old noted that mishaps like the stage collapse should not be blamed on a single entity, as  organising large-scale such events involves complexities.

    Situations like that can be avoided, and I think the company that hosted the show, which is Native, released a statement that they’re carrying out investigations with the stage and production company,” Odumodublvck explained.

    “People don’t know things like this. When they say come and do shows, there’s a production company, light people, sound people and security.”

    He further clarified: “People think it’s just one person, but it’s good to educate people that there are different factions of this thing to put up a show.

    “You can’t really point fingers at one person or everyone for one person’s mistake. All in all, we thank God nobody died, and the casualties have been taken care of to the best of my knowledge.”

    Why I didn’t attend university – Ice Prince

    Feel Good” frontline hip hop rapper and singer Ice Prince has gone down memory lane, recalling the hardships he faced growing up as an orphan.

    Ice Prince Zamani, as he is fondly called sometimes, during a recent feature with Listen With Osi podcast, revealed that financial constraints hindered him from pursuing higher education.

    The ‘Oleku’ hitmaker further disclosed that turn after his life took a dramatic turn after he lost his father at 11 and his mother at 21.

    He said, “I don’t have a mother, I’m an only son and that’s quite tough. I’ve been that way since I was 11 years old when I lost my dad.

    “I was 21 or 22 when my mum passed away and I have a family that depends on me. I don’t have any uncles, aunties, Godfathers, or Godmothers that I can depend on. It’s been nothing but God in my life.”

    According to the 38-year-old, he had to take on different menial jobs, to support himself and make ends meet.

    He said despite his best efforts, he could not pursue a university education due to a lack of funds, specifically N20,000.

    “I just want people to look at my life and be like, ‘if this imperfect human can be somebody, I have no excuse to fail.’ I was the guy who would spend at least 3 weeks out of every school term at home because of school fees,” he said.

    “I didn’t go to university because of N20,000 which is like one spliff now. That’s the reason I didn’t go, because of N20,000.”I had two weeks to pay that money for registration and I couldn’t come up with it and that’s how I lost the admission and I became a studio rat from there.”

    ‘I didn’t get preferential treatment’ – Ice Prince recalls experience at Ikoyi Prison

    Feel Good” frontliner, hip hop rapper and singer Ice Prince has opened up about his difficult experience at the Ikoyi Correctional Centre in Lagos.

    Recall, the Ice Prince Zamani as he is fondly called sometimes, was remanded following allegations of assaulting a police officer.

    Speaking on the latest episode of the Listen podcast, Ice Prince described the experience of spending  six days at the facility as “horrible,’’ noting that he had no preferential treatment.

    “I didn’t get preferential treatment. It’s a prison, so there was no preferential treatment. I’m not talking about a police cell.

    “I’ve seen celebrities who come out of police cells bragging as if they went through some stuff, but if you’ve never been to prison, you haven’t seen it yet,” he said.

    The ‘Oleku’ singer however reflected on the friendship that was formed with fellow inmates, likening the experience to “a different institution of higher learning.”

    He said, “I made friends in there. We hung out and chatted. It’s a different world. I don’t pray for my worst enemy to experience it.”

    Phyno slams critic over Hushpuppi feature in new song

    Popular rapper Phyno has been awoken from his usual social media recluse by responding to criticism for featuring jailed internet fraudster, Hushpuppi on his new album.

    TheNewsGuru.com (TNG) reports that the rapper featured the jailed internet fraudster, Hushpuppi in track 10 ‘Nwoke Esike’ of his much-anticipated album ‘Full Time Job’.

    In the music, Hushpuppi’s voice offers advice on hard work and perseverance.

    Hushpuppi said no one should compete with themselves, adding that “everybody’s destination dey different”.

    “Do your best at all time and pray for yourself/ Hahah I see say pleasure to do unboxing video won kill a lot of people/ Abeg take am easy on yourself/ Go work hard abeg/ life is too short,” he said in the song.

    Reacting, An X user questioned Phyno’s motive, asking what wisdom people could gain from a convicted fraudster.

    “I still don’t understand what Phyno was trying to do on that track by bringing Hushpuppi to ‘motivate’ us,” the user wrote.

    In response, Phyno slammed the critic for his ignorance about music promotion.

    The rapper argued that if he had featured a convicted US rapper like Young Thug, fans would eagerly listen without hesitation.

    “Go and sleep if u no sabi game!!! If young thug or el chapo talk for song now you go rush first play am..  ngwere isi red !!” Phyno wrote.

    Why I took a break from music – Rapper, Illbliss

    Famous Nigerian  rapper and actor,  Tobechukwu Ejiofor, popularly known as  Illbliss, has explained that he took a sabbatical from music to diversify.

    The rapper said he has been trying his hands in movies, documentaries and other forms of creativity.

    According to him, being a dad was also a major factor for his break from music.

    Illbliss featured as a guest in a recent episode of Hip TV programme, Trending, hosted by reality star KimOprah.

    He said, “My two kids came miraculously. My first child was born eight years after I married my wife while my second daughter born during the COVID-19 lockdown. So I took time off to be a dad; to spend time with my family and raise my kids.

    “Also, I was trying to find diversification. So I moved into television as well. I had done ‘King Of Boys’ a year before then and I just felt like I needed to produce more; shoot more films, documentaries and get into spaces where I could still express myself artistically without just putting out music. So, I took a break from music. All of these is what has been happening in the last four years.”

    Late rapper, Mohbad laid to rest in Lagos

    Nigerian rapper, Ilerioluwa Oladimeji Aloba, popularly known as Mohbad, has been laid to rest in the Ikorodu area of  Lagos state.

    The KpK crooner died on Tuesday, September 12 in Lagos.

    Details surrounding the cause of his death are still sketchy but there are insinuations of heart complication as a result of drugs.

    However, fans and well-wishers of the singer have taken to different media platforms to mourn him. Meanwhile, a fresh video shows the moment the remains of the singer were laid to rest.
